Transaction 9695e810786ddde3ed7c5900e9d2395b7190eb9d530ceb2a165ace46bfc6211a

1 Input
2 Outputs
  • 9695e810786ddde3ed7c5900e9d2395b7190eb9d530ceb2a165ace46bfc6211a:0
  • value  38277481
    address  bc1qds07l99rg6vlz7wtrcpkh8sz2dd87yuygj56wv2tf3kvs62nyprspq6s9v
  • 9695e810786ddde3ed7c5900e9d2395b7190eb9d530ceb2a165ace46bfc6211a:1
  • value  53734625
    address  1HkuCLQhViZ8dQquByftsjZkKjpKKjByk9